  • Abstract
    Transistorized pulse width modulated (PWM) inverters require careful dimensioning of turn-on and turn-off circuits in order to minimize the switching loss in the power transistors. The paper describes new lossless circuits. Especially the turn-off circuits show a highly reduced part count as compared to circuits known from the literature. Also the turn-on circuits apply energy recovery. Furthermore, due to a special circuit, the voltage across the power transistor is strictly limited. This is very important especially due to the usually low voltage blocking capability of high current power transistors.
